Output a8850e98656b6e1004eb36cdd05767ac4ee6814b2ea8262ea27de4ae4dd9ba86:1

value
17053637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dabab61e4ff7be5283feda11f5441088566a7077 OP_EQUAL
address
3MdYuJFhfAriyjy2TvJu6ZrMk3DcG4NZQY
transaction
a8850e98656b6e1004eb36cdd05767ac4ee6814b2ea8262ea27de4ae4dd9ba86
spent
true